A paedophile who abused babies less than six months old died in custody.
An inquest into the death of Jared Perry at Pontypridd Coroners' Court heard evidence about the events leading up to Perry's death at the Princess of Wales hospital in Bridgend on Sunday, November 3, 2019. The 32-year-old was discovered unresponsive in his cell at HMP Parc Prison, Bridgend, around midday on Wednesday, October 30, 2019.
Perry was taken to hospital where he remained in a coma before dying due to complications of hanging. A prison officer told juror that he "should have removed" an item from Perry's cell which he used to harm himself, Wales Online reports.

The jury thus found prison staff had failed to observe Perry, delayed transferring him to a secure mental health unit, and failed to remove an item from his cell that contributed to his death.
Swansea Crown Court head in January 2019 how Perry abused both male and female children before he confessed to his crimes to the police. Perry, of Llanilar, Aberystwyth, admitted to 10 counts of indecent assault and sexual assault on a child under 13.
Some of his victims were as young as a few months old. Perry was described as an "extremely high risk" to children and was given a 17-year sentence comprising of 10 years in prison and an extended seven-year term on licence. The inquest which opened on Monday, March 18 heard evidence from 26 witnesses in total.
10 of those witnesses provided statements for the coroner, Graeme Hughes, to read out. Meanwhile, 16 provided evidence remotely or in person.
